#8f1748 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#8f1748 is composed of 56.1% red, 9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83.9% magenta, 49.7%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 335.5 degrees, a saturation of 72.3% and a lightness of 32.5%. #8f1748 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2e90 with #1f0000. Closest websafe color is: #990033.

Shades and Tints of #8f1748

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080104 is the darkest color, while #fef6f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#8f1748

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#565053 is the less saturated color, while #a20444 is the most saturated one.
